  • About [OCLC – PromptCat]

    “PromptCat provides cataloging records for new materials that can be ready to shelve the moment you receive them. OCLC works with leading library partners to automate this process. Best of all, your holdings are added to WorldCat, the bibliographic databa

    (tags: world)

  • Amazon is new OCLC PromptCat participant [OCLC]

    “DUBLIN, Ohio, USA, 14 September 2006—Amazon.com is now an OCLC PromptCat participant, making it possible for libraries to receive OCLC MARC records along with the materials they get from the online vendor including books, music, DVDs and more.”

    (tags: worldcat)

  • PromptCat [OCLC – Cataloging and Metadata]

    “Participating partners send OCLC electronic lists that identify the books, videos and other materials you’ve ordered. PromptCat then matches the items to bibliographic records in WorldCat, adds local data to records, sets holdings in WorldCat and provide

    (tags: worldcat)
